These are the only pikes that I can depend on finding in my area on a consistent basis. I thought about getting one but I don't think it will get along with my Lucius. Belly Crawlers act like they hate each other in the tank at the LFS. Granted it's a small tank though. They look nice.
 
They are scrappy, but, only with each other in my experience. I would encourage anyone to get some of these, they are non stop action! No real damage to each other either.

So you think they would be okay with similar sized pikes? I'm just really hesitant about adding another pike. I know mine isn't rare or anything but he's my first pike and I really like his personality. I'd hate for anything to happen to him.
 
Mine are with Atabapo II's and they were with Sveni when I picked them up. . . never have had a problem with them myself. You just never can tell of course.
